Unstoppable is a 2010 American disaster action thriller film directed and produced by Tony Scott and starring Denzel Washington and Chris Pine. It is based on the real-life CSX 8888 incident, telling the story of a runaway freight train and the two men who attempt to stop it. It was the last film Tony Scott directed before his death in 2012. The SD40-2s acquired by CSX in the division of Conrail during 1999 were renumbered as 8800 series on the roster. As fate would have it, the #6410 was renumbered #8888.
